  • Title

    Two-photon UV fluorescence excitation of the amino acids by a frequency doubled femtosecond optical parametric oscillator

  • Abstract
    In this study, we have demonstrated the use of a frequency-doubled femtosecond optical parametric oscillator in generating two-photon excitation that is equivalent to ultraviolet (UV) light with wavelength less than 300 nm. This capability allows observation of some amino acids and enables excitation that is only possible with wavelength in UVB range (290 nm-320 nm).
